Description
The Allen-Bradley 1756-IR6I is a ControlLogix analog input module with six isolated channels for RTD and resistor inputs. It enables accurate temperature and resistance measurement in industrial automation systems.
Technical Specifications
Brand | Allen-Bradley |
Manufacturer | Rockwell Automation |
Part Number | 1756-IR6I |
Series | ControlLogix |
Module Type | Analog RTD Module |
Inputs | 6-Point Isolated RTD |
Compatible RTD Type | Platinum 100, 200, 500, 1000 ? , alpha=385; Platinum 100, 200, 500, 1000 ? Platinum, alpha=3916; Nickel 120 ?, alpha=672, Nickel 100, 120, 200, 500 ? , alpha=618 |
Resolution | 16 bits 1…487 ?: 7.7 m?/bit 2…1000 ?:15 m?/bit 4…2000 ?:30 m?/bit 8…4020 ?:60 m?/bit |
Input Range | 1…487 ? 2…1000 ? 4…2000 ? 8…4000 ? |
Module Scan Time | 25 ms min floating point (ohms) 50 ms min floating point (temperature) 10 ms min integer (ohms)(1) |
Maximum Input Current, Off-State | 2.75 milliamperes |
Data Format | Integer mode (left justified, 2s complement) IEEE 32-bit floating point |
Backplane Current (5Volts) | 250 milliamps |
Backplane Current at 24 Volts | 2 milliamperes |
Backplane Current (24 Volts) | 125 milliamps |
Power Dissipation (Max) | 4.3 Watts |
Removable Terminal Blocks | 1756-TBNH, 1756-TBSH |
Maximum Operating Current | 1.2 milliamperes at 30 Volts AC, 60 Hertz |
Information About 1756-IR6I
The 1756-IR6I is part of the Allen-Bradley ControlLogix family, designed to provide precise resistance and temperature monitoring with high flexibility. It supports six individually isolated RTD or resistor inputs with selectable input ranges from 1 to 4000 ohms. The module delivers 16-bit resolution with detailed scaling values (7.7 mΩ/bit to 60 mΩ/bit depending on range) and supports both integer and IEEE 32-bit floating-point data formats. With fast scan times of 25 ms for resistance and 50 ms for temperature, it ensures timely process feedback. Operating with a maximum power dissipation of 4.3 W, it requires 250 mA at 5 VDC and 125 mA at 24 VDC from the backplane. The 1756-IR6I integrates seamlessly into ControlLogix chassis, making it essential for accurate sensing in temperature-critical industrial applications.
